Output f3ecdcb3dfa1edcc318c9c71be192ffb19db93914a00f0e92c553750a90ab6dd:20

value
302900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f52d7fe4d5451b8107f10be6b5f88785bb807a7 OP_EQUAL
address
3GDSc8MfxqKjumKMngZfJGJ58VTz36QB6p
transaction
f3ecdcb3dfa1edcc318c9c71be192ffb19db93914a00f0e92c553750a90ab6dd
confirmations
396475
spent
true